The role of sphingosine-1-phosphate in the development and progression of Parkinson’s disease

Parkinson’s disease (PD) could be viewed as a proteinopathy caused by changes in lipids, whereby modifications in lipid metabolism may lead to protein alterations, such as the accumulation of alpha-synuclein (α-syn), ultimately resulting in neurodegeneration.
